CPI finalises candidates for Lok Sbaha polls

CPI, the second largest partner in the CPI(M) led LDF, has finalised candidates in the four seats it is contesting in Kerala.
Former member of Public Service Commission and a prominent member of the Church of South India Bennet P Abraham has been named as the candidate for Thiruvananthapuram.
Party sources said Abraham's name was cleared despite objections from several members of CPI-M'S state executive and state council.
Chengara Surendran (Mavelikara), C N Jayadevan (Thrissur) and Sathyan Mokeri (Wayanad), are the other candidates.
The party state committee met here yesterday and gave approval to the candidate list.
LDF is meeting later in the day to finalise the list of candidates after which a formal announcement would be made, sources said.
LDF has allotted Kottayam seat to JDS in which Mathew T Thomas, presently MLA from Thiruvalla assembly constituency will be the candidate.
